Can u give me the node browser query whose input is a uuid of a folder in spacesstore and a text to be searched.
PARENT: "workspace://SpacesStore/ec002e32-f392-4ea1-967e-7e6009d74c7f" AND TYPE:"{http://www.alfresco.org/model/content/1.0}content" AND TEXT:"bb"

PARENT: "workspace://SpacesStore/2fc87f4b-a13f-4c3c-ad26-bbaced8c4819" AND TEXT:"content*" AND TYPE:"{http://www.alfresco.org/model/content/1.0}content"
This query does find the text in the folder specified by uuid. But it does not search in the hierarchy of folders under it.It just searches in one level.08-12-2009 05:22 AM
